SteamVR Gets New ‘Theater Screen’ for Playing Flatscreen Games in VR

Road to VR

Valve released the SteamVR Beta 2.1.1 update which includes a new way to play flatscreen games in VR. Called SteamVR Theater Screen, the new function is said to replace the old Desktop Game Theater app , which was first released in 2016. Like Desktop Game Theater, the new Theater Screen is a way of playing non-VR games from a large, virtual screen—i.e. it doesn’t turn your non-VR games into actual VR games.

‘Arizona Sunshine’ Studio Working on Unannounced “AAA VR game” Based on a Global Franchise

Road to VR

According to a recent job offer posted by Amsterdam-based developer Vertigo Games, pre-production has begun on a “high-profile, multiplatform AAA VR game,” which is said to be based on a globally recognized franchise. Posted earlier this month, the studio is looking for a Lead Level Designer with a proven track record in level design for console/PC action-adventure games as well as expertise in Unreal Engine.

ByteDance-Owned Pico Is Laying Off A Significant Portion Of Its Workforce

Upload VR

Pico is laying off a large number of employees as it works to "restructure" its business. Update November 7: ByteDance confirmed that layoffs were taking place but denied the claimed scale, and provided a statement. Tencent Technology News reports that these layoffs are "widespread and are expected to affect more than a thousand employees", bringing Pico's workforce down to just "hundreds" compared to the peak of around 2000.

Nimo: Productivity-Focused Smart Glasses With A Compute Puck & Spatial OS

Upload VR

Nimo is a productivity-focused spatial computing package consisting of smart glasses and a tethered puck with a spatial operating system. Existing smart media glasses like the XREAL Air series focus on showing any USB-C (or HDMI with the beam adapter) display source on a virtual screen in front of you. Nimo instead uses a tethered compute puck with a mobile chipset running an custom Android-based operating system designed for productivity.

SteamVR Beta Shows Correct Controller Models For Quest 3 & Pro And Upgrades Theater Mode

Upload VR

A beta update to SteamVR adds render models for Meta's Touch Plus and Touch Pro controllers, and a new Theater Screen for 2D games and applications. When using Quest 3's new Touch Plus controllers or last year's Touch Pro controllers (which come with Quest Pro and are compatible with Quest 2 and 3) SteamVR has until now shown Quest 2's Touch controllers.

Creed: Rise To Glory Update Adds A Familiar Foe, Hand Tracking & More

Upload VR

Creed: Rise To Glory receives hand-tracking support, Quest 3 enhancements and a familiar adversary in a free update. Over five years after its initial release, Creed: Rise To Glory continues receiving new updates after April's ' Championship Edition ' introduced new content based on Creed III. Today, Survios announced Rise To Glory will now add Tommy “The Machine” Gunn, Rocky Balboa's main adversary from 1990's Rocky V.
